NEW YORK, Sept. 25 (UPI) -- Victoria's Secret will hold open casting events to find a new Runway Angel for the next "Victoria's Secret Fashion Show," CBS said.

The winning contestant will join supermodels Alessandra Ambrosio, Miranda Kerr, Doutzen Kroes, Marisa Miller and others as they model the lingerie giant's fashions in a show to be broadcast on the network Dec. 1.

Casting events will be held in New York, Miami, Los Angeles and Chicago, beginning Oct. 3. Contestants can also enter online at VSAllAccess.com and CBS.com Oct. 1-24.

A Victoria's Secret panel of experts will narrow the field to 10 finalists and will then hand over the final selection to the public. People will vote to choose the winner in an online video and voting process, CBS said.

Beginning Oct. 14, VSAllAccess.com and CBS.com will air weekly Web-isodes featuring footage from the live castings and Angel Boot Camp.
